Mount cameras at least 8–10 feet high to prevent tampering while ensuring a clear view. Angle them toward entry points and high-risk areas, avoiding obstructions like trees or walls. Use weatherproof housings for outdoor cameras.

For wired setups, route cables discreetly along walls or ceilings. If using a wireless system, ensure a stable Wi-Fi connection and minimal interference.
